Myths Regarding LASIK Discomfort
Contrary to common belief, LASIK surgical procedure isn't as uncomfortable as many individuals believe. The treatment itself is fairly fast and painless. You may feel some stress or pain during the surgical treatment, yet it's usually very little. The cosmetic surgeon will certainly make use of numbing eye goes down to ensure that you do not feel any type of pain throughout the procedure.
While it's typical to experience some dry skin, itching, or mild pain in the hours complying with the surgical treatment, this can generally be handled with non-prescription pain medicine and eye declines. It is essential to follow your medical professional's post-operative care directions to reduce any kind of pain and advertise correct recovery.
Remember that every person's discomfort resistance is different, so what a single person may refer to as awkward may be totally bearable for an additional. Feel confident that LASIK pain is usually not a major problem and should not deter you from considering this life-altering procedure.
Threats Connected With LASIK
Lots of individuals undertaking LASIK surgical treatment are mainly concerned about potential threats related to the treatment. While LASIK is a risk-free and effective treatment for vision Correction, like any type of procedure, it does include some threats.

In unusual instances, even more significant issues such as infection, corneal flap problems, and vision loss can occur, yet the chance of these problems is very reduced when the surgical treatment is done by a proficient and seasoned eye doctor. It's important to go over these risks with your doctor throughout the consultation to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.

While LASIK is frequently related to d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ision problems can also be eligible candidates. In fact, innovations in LASIK technology have broadened the variety of treatable prescriptions, allowing even more individuals to gain from the treatment.
LASIK eligibility is identified with a comprehensive eye examination by a qualified eye doctor. Elements such as corneal density, eye health, and general medical history play a vital role in evaluating an individual's suitability for the surgical treatment.
Also individuals over 40, who may have presbyopia (age-related trouble focusing on close items), can possibly undertake LASIK or various other vision Correction procedures.
It's important not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gical treatment. Consulting with a knowledgeable eye treatment professional is the most effective way to determine if you're an ideal prospect for this life-changing procedure.
